Description
The CNY17-2 is a reliable, high-performance optocoupler that provides excellent electrical isolation between input and output circuits. It consists of a gallium arsenide (GaAs) infrared-emitting diode (IRED) optically coupled to a silicon NPN phototransistor, all housed in an industry-standard 6-pin dual-in-line (DIP-6) package.
This device is engineered to transmit signal information—including DC levels—while maintaining a high degree of galvanic isolation. It is widely used to replace traditional relays and transformers in digital interface applications and analog circuits like CRT modulation, providing superior long-term stability and protection against electrical noise.

Features
- Isolation: High 5000 VRMS isolation test voltage for superior safety
- Design: GaAs IRED coupled with a silicon NPN phototransistor
- Stability: Excellent long-term operational stability
- Package: Industry-standard DIP-6 through-hole package
- Versatility: Suitable for both digital logic and analog signal transmission
